As for me I just got my wife a purple 2008 Agility 50 @ 3500km for 600euros.
The scooter had been sitting for a loooong time and really didn't want to start, but all it needed was some new fuel/oil and a bath.

I have read allot about derestricting these guys and just wanted to confirm a couple things.

1. When I cut the Cdi box, do I need to up the jet or removing the rev limiter really should't
run me any leaner?
2. I will bring the boss to a local fabricator (2 block away :)) to throw it on the lathe for a second, but once installed what jet size should I install (82)?
3. For the time being this is all I want to do as my wife has only ridden for a couple months. ( I am a gear-head and engineer but will resist other modifications.........for now!)

4. Wanted to confirm NGK part # as I like using iridium and have a local vendor for them.
My wife drives 7.4km each way and isn't a real racer, so a hotter plug may be a little better (CR6HSA) or should i stick with a CR7HSA?

Loomin....Looks like a good four point foot.......Mine (the best that I could get) was just bolted at two points (into the rear view mirrors), but I was able to force it against the front cowling with a section of water pipe insulation (spunge tubing) as a cushionto take up any vibration, and provide a third point (foot).
It has held up nicely now for thousands of miles without a murmur.
